So if you’re running a bing, and tuning your setup, you’re opening the carb top a lot, am I right? You’re changing the needle setting, running it, changing the needle setting again, etc. Anyway, this wears out the gasket at the top of the carb pretty quickly, and then you have an air leak there, and you have to buy an expensive gasket to fix it.

Fuck that. I went to the hardware store and picked up a 1/16” thick O-ring that fit nicely in the carb top, and switched it out for the factory gasket. It works like a charm. So screw buying new gaskets, just go to the hardware store and pick up a $0.34 O-ring.

I do realize it’s possible that the rubber will dissolve with exposure to gasoline, but it’s in the top of the carb, and that doesn’t get a lot of fuel flow going through there, so I’m not worried about it. I also used an O-ring to seal my connection from my carb to the intake, and I haven’t had trouble with that, so I’m thinking it should be fine.
